Job Overview:
The Sr Digital Developer position at the American Heart Association involves designing, developing, and modifying web applications and integration software to support the AHA's digital fundraising initiatives. This role requires gathering requirements, conducting development testing, and addressing defects throughout the software development lifecycle. The developer will work with various technologies, including React, Ionic React, and Nest.js, and will be responsible for ensuring that the applications meet the needs of end users while adhering to the organization's development standards. The position emphasizes collaboration and communication, as the developer will interact with stakeholders to clarify business requirements and provide project support.
Duties and Responsibilities:
The primary duties and responsibilities of the Sr Digital Developer include:
- Designing, developing, and maintaining web applications using technologies such as React, Ionic React, Nest.js, and Typescript.
- Developing software artifacts based on requirements and adhering to solution and application architecture standards.
- Conducting unit and integrated testing of developed software, supporting user acceptance testing, and remediating defects as necessary.
- Managing incoming tickets and defects, including preliminary debugging, triaging issues, and communicating status updates to customers.
- Supporting the clarification and refinement of business requirements to ensure alignment with project goals.
- Providing estimations based on functional specifications and requirements.
- Offering coordination, production, and project support to ensure successful project delivery.
Required Qualifications:
Candidates must possess a Bachelor's Degree or equivalent experience, along with a minimum of 5 years of relevant experience in software development. Proficiency in technologies such as React, Ionic React, Nest.js, and Typescript is essential. Experience with ticketing systems for troubleshooting web application defects and debugging using in-browser tools is required. Familiarity with Visual Studio Team Services (VSTS)/Azure DevOps or similar project tracking tools is also necessary. Strong customer service orientation, excellent communication skills, and a solutions-oriented mindset with good problem-solving abilities are critical for success in this role.

Additional Notes:
This is a full-time position with a competitive salary range of $115,000 - $121,000, commensurate with experience. The American Heart Association offers a comprehensive benefits package, including medical, dental, vision, disability, and life insurance, as well as a robust retirement program with employer matching. Employees are entitled to a minimum of 16 days of Paid Time Off (PTO) per year, increasing with seniority, and 12 paid holidays annually. The organization also supports professional development through tuition assistance and access to its corporate university, Heart U. The AHA is committed to fostering an inclusive workplace and encourages applications from diverse backgrounds.
